Transaction 758319315e39e38ccb57408220bbe82c9343021ceb3b2a2bfa820b748a4107af

1 Input
2 Outputs
  • 758319315e39e38ccb57408220bbe82c9343021ceb3b2a2bfa820b748a4107af:0
  • value  53447834
    address  37731VLHkhYm5LfK2BhgojTMEey5naiPMt
  • 758319315e39e38ccb57408220bbe82c9343021ceb3b2a2bfa820b748a4107af:1
  • value  3254166
    address  3GJFTBDRD5qDAsQgNYtak5EZywDNcdZi7v